2011-05-18 85 views
2

我在.NET中創建一個WCF服務。在服務我增加了一個名爲XYZ的功能:WCF服務方法

public int XYZ(int a){ 
return a+a; 
} 

當我在我的web應用程序添加Web服務的Web引用和訪問功能XYZ,這需要兩個參數一個爲int類型,第二是的bool類型。

但是我最初是在WCF服務又增加了單參數XYZ功能。

如果有人有想法,那麼請讓我知道如何處理這個問題。因爲我的wcf服務將從flash代碼中調用。

+0

可能重複的[Web引用代理是字段指定的](http://stackoverflow.com/questions/3531117/web-reference-proxy-is-field-specified) – 2011-05-18 13:55:49

回答

2

如果要添加一個網絡參考項目,而不是服務參考,那麼你會得到"extra" parameters as described here.你應該添加一個服務引用來爲你服務的代理說的WCF的ServiceContract描述匹配您的服務。此外,「額外」參數只對基於ASMX的客戶端顯示。 Flash客戶端不需要調用WCF服務。

+0

謝謝西薩,我得到了答案 – munish 2011-05-18 13:47:13

+0

偉大!如果答案是你需要的,你也應該將其標記爲已接受。謝謝!! – 2011-05-18 13:54:29